PlayStation 5 VR is Definitelyon the Table

Sony launched the PlayStation VR in October, 2016 so when PS5 comes out, it’ll definitely be PSVR ready.The PSVR is anaffordable version of Oculus Rift and HTC Vive at $399 / 349 / AUD$549 / 399. There’s a catch. Sony is currently struggling to meet the demands of its new virtual reality headset, especially with the arrival of PS4 Pro and Slim. By the time PS5 comes out, the PSVR too will evolve and it’ll be interestingtoexperience the two devices together.

PlayStation 5 Price

At this point, it’s hard to tell how much will PlayStation 5 cost.With the PS2 costing 300, the PS3 425 and the PS4 349,thelaunch price of PS5 will most likely cost around $400.
